diff --git a/client/codepuppy.py b/client/codepuppy.py index c9794e111..faf84bc91 100644 --- a/client/codepuppy.py +++ b/client/codepuppy.py @@ -37,6 +37,8 @@ def __init__(self): self._params = CmdArgParser.parse_args() # 日志输出设置 self.__setup_logger() + # 打印版本信息 + self.__print_client_version() if getattr(sys, 'frozen', False) and hasattr(sys, '_MEIPASS'): LogPrinter.info('running in a PyInstaller bundle') @@ -49,6 +51,12 @@ def __init__(self): # 默认git配置 GitConfig.set_default_config() + def __print_client_version(self): + """打印TCA客户端版本信息""" + LogPrinter.info("=" * 39) + LogPrinter.info(f"*** TCA Client v{settings.VERSION}({settings.EDITION.name} Beta) ***") + LogPrinter.info("=" * 39) + def __setup_logger(self): """日志打印配置 diff --git a/client/settings/edition.py b/client/settings/edition.py index df9932339..5f6a81f6e 100644 --- a/client/settings/edition.py +++ b/client/settings/edition.py @@ -28,4 +28,4 @@ class Edition(Enum): # 版本号 # ======================== # puppy版本号,格式:浮点数,整数部分为8位日期,小数部分为编号(从1开始) -VERSION = 20220907.1 +VERSION = 20240716.1